Roof Vent Flashing Repair in Littleton, CO
Roof vent flashing repair involves inspecting and replacing the metal or rubber flashing that surrounds roof vents to ensure a proper seal against water intrusion. This service covers a variety of projects, including fixing leaks around attic vents, bathroom exhaust fans, and other roof penetrations. Property owners should understand that damaged or improperly installed flashing can lead to water leaks, mold growth, and structural damage, making timely repairs essential for maintaining the roof’s integrity and preventing costly issues.
Before requesting roof vent flashing repair, homeowners typically want to know about the condition of existing flashing, whether it shows signs of rust, cracks, or warping, and if there are visible leaks or water stains inside the property. It’s also helpful to understand the types of vent flashing suitable for different roof styles and materials, as well as any necessary preparatory steps to ensure a durable, long-lasting repair. Proper assessment and replacement help protect the home from weather-related damage and extend the lifespan of the roofing system.

Roof Vent Flashing Repair Questions
What causes roof vent flashing to need repair? Damage from weather, age, or improper installation can lead to leaks or deterioration of vent flashing.
How can I tell if my roof vent flashing is damaged? Signs include water stains on ceilings, visible rust or cracks around vents, and persistent leaks during rain.
What types of roof vents typically require flashing repair? Attic vents, exhaust vents, and chimney vents are common types that may need flashing maintenance or replacement.
Why is proper flashing important for roof vents? Proper flashing prevents water infiltration around vents, helping to protect the roof structure and interior spaces.
